**As of May 12, 2023 , project was awarded to Underground Utilities, awarded amount is $2,707,377.47.** In accordance with Ohio Revised Code Section 7.16 this shall serve as notification that this notice is available on the City of Fremont's website at the following online The bids will be accompanied by a bid check or bid bond. Bid check must be a certified or cashiers' check, in the amount of ten percent (10%) of the amount bid, made payable to the City of Fremont. Bid bond must be in the sum of not less than one hundred percent (100%) of the amount of the bid and must be that of an approved surety company authorized to transact business in the State of Ohio and with local agent. Bond must meet the satisfaction of the City of Fremont Law Director. If the bid is rejected, the bid bond will be returned with notice. On bids accepted, the bond will be returned upon completion of a contract. A performance bond will be required to complete the contract. The right is reserved, by the Safety Service Director of the City of Fremont, Ohio, to reject any or all bids, and to waive technical defects, irregularities and informalities as the interest of the City may require. Any technical questions concerning this project should be directed to the City Engineer's office at 419-334-8963. Any bid questions should be directed to the Administrative Office at 419-334-2687.
